# Cc. Madhya 25.170
## Text
> āmi bojhā vahimu, tomā-sabāra duḥkha haila
> tomā-sabāra icchāya vinā-mūlye bilāila
## Synonyms
*āmi*—I; *bojhā*—burden; *vahimu*—shall carry; *tomā*-*sabāra* *duḥkha* *haila*—all of you became very unhappy; *tomā*-*sabāra* *icchāya*—only by your will; *vinā*-*mūlye* *bilāila*—I distributed without a price.
## Translation
**"All of you were feeling unhappy that no one was purchasing My goods and that I would have to carry them away. Therefore, by your will only, I have distributed them without charging."**
## Purport
When we began distributing the message of Śrī Caitanya Mahāprabhu in the Western countries, a similar thing happened. In the beginning we were very disappointed for at least one year because no one came forth to help this movement, but by the grace of Śrī Caitanya Mahāprabhu, some young boys joined this movement in 1966. Of course we distributed Śrī Caitanya Mahāprabhu's message of the Hare Kṛṣṇa *mahā-mantra* without bargaining or selling. As a result, this movement has spread all over the world, with the assistance of European and American boys and girls. We therefore pray for all the blessings of Śrī Caitanya Mahāprabhu upon all the devotees in the Western world who are spreading this movement.
